Output b0f660037153ace521f5e8e8a28062c53d6cf0d4bc341b7d15b77d4a79a07761:1

value
435600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52aaf3ba2f168d9663c3a677c1f5a12a5786e597 OP_EQUAL
address
39E88EMydcxzdYnD7ypt9mrbn1jbGaXPft
transaction
b0f660037153ace521f5e8e8a28062c53d6cf0d4bc341b7d15b77d4a79a07761
confirmations
417087
spent
true